Chapel Hill Elementary School is seeking a Library Media Specialist who enjoys working with teachers to design lessons supporting the curriculum and using media resources. The candidate should also enjoy working with students to foster a love of reading and technology.

Title: Media Specialist
Administer and curate a diverse collection of media resources to support instruction, promote literacy, and foster a culture of reading and lifelong learning. Provide technology assistance as needed. Work independently with minimal supervision, applying intermediate-level knowledge as an experienced contributor.
Essential Job Duties
- Monitor and manage the library space for open access.
- Collaborate with teachers to integrate literacy and technology into the curriculum.
- Curate a collection of books, digital media, and research materials supporting student learning.
- Manage library operations, including circulation, budgeting, and procurement.
- Promote reading and literacy through clubs and activities.
- Assist with educational technologies to enhance learning.
- Organize and maintain library resources for easy access.
- Perform administrative tasks such as webmaster duties and media production.
- Stay updated on educational technology trends and best practices.
- Identify and resolve moderately complex issues.
- Modify processes to improve departmental performance.
- Ensure compliance with regulations and policies.
- Perform additional duties as assigned.
Qualifications
- Master's Degree in Communications, Media Studies, Journalism, Public Relations, or related field with 3-5 years of relevant experience.
- Valid Professional Standards Commission S-5 certificate or higher.
